Hang the Deer. Find a suitable location to hang the deer, such as a tree limb or a deer-hoisting setup. Hanging the deer makes the skinning process easier by providing better access to the body. For a single deer hide, a 5-gallon plastic bucket works well with a ratio of 0.4 ounces of lye or 1 oz of hydrated lime per gallon of water. Make sure your hide is fully submerged in the solution and weigh it down with a stone if needed. Ring around the neck behind the ears, around the legs, then, cut the hide in strips about 2 inches wide. Pull the strips off with catfish pliers/strippers. Don't forget, hange em by the head. The hide is now stretched out flat and tight. Stand the frame up so that the hide is roughly perpendicular to the ground. You can lean the frame against a tree or a post to hold it in place; the skin is now accessible for scraping.

Cutting the coring ring. Place the deer on the ground with its belly towards the sky. Get into a comfortable kneeling position, locate the anus, and cut the coring ring of the deer a few inches deep. Slide the knife a little deeper into its pelvic canal and remove the last inches of the colon.

Measure and mark the locations for the two holes that you'll dig. The holes should be six feet apart. Step 2. Dig with a shovel and post hole digger two holes 24 inches deep. Dry the hide on a wooden rack for 3-4 days. Using a sewing needle, pierce holes every 1–2 inches (2.5–5.1 cm) along the edge of the hide, and thread twine through the holes. Pull the twine until it's taut, then securely tie it to a drying rack—you can find these at your local hunting shop or make one at home using scrap wood.

Hang the Deer. If you haven’t already hung the deer, that’s your first step. You should stick the hooks of the gambrel in the rear part of the deer’s knees between the joint and rear tendon. Second best is to use treated 4x4s. In both cases, you can get swingset brackets that make the job easy. Look for either metal pipe swingset brackets or just swingset brackets for wood.Instagram:https://instagram. costco woodbury gas hoursholman mortuary abbeville alsubmarine sauce publixpooh shiesty tattoo Unit is equipped with two 5" x 2” rigid and four swivel casters with a foot action floor stop mounted on swivel end.
